39 /*
40  * driver for homePNA PHYs
41  * This is really just a stub that allows us to identify homePNA-based
42  * transceicers and display the link status. MII-based homePNA PHYs
43  * only support one media type and no autonegotiation. If we were
44  * really clever, we could tweak some of the vendor-specific registers
45  * to optimize the link.
46  */
